Biogenetic effects

Pertuzumab is a monoclonal antibody which interacts with a protein on the surface of cancer cells, known as human epidermal growth factor receptor 2 (HER2). This protein plays a key role in stimulating the growth of cancer cells. By attaching to this protein, Pertuzumab prevents its normal functioning of it, which leads to the suppression of cancer cell growth. This makes Pertuzumab an effective targeted therapy for certain types of cancer, especially when used in combination with other cancer drugs.

Specialized mode of its effects

Pertuzumab injections are used to treat advanced breast cancer. In breast cancers which overproduce the HER2 protein, Pertuzumab has been found to be especially effective in combination with other treatments, such as chemotherapies, in controlling the symptoms and slowing down cancer growth.
